Pennine School is a new independent special school for pupils aged 10–18 with Social, Emotional and Mental Health (SEMH) needs. We are committed to creating a calm, nurturing and purposeful environment where every pupil is supported to succeed academically and personally. Our vision — “Believe you can achieve” — underpins everything we do.
We are now recruiting an enthusiastic and experienced Maths Teacher to join our growing team. This is a unique opportunity to contribute to the foundation of a specialist school designed to meet pupils’ individual learning needs and prepare them for success in GCSEs, functional skills and beyond.
